What does Faraday's Law state?
Back
Faraday's Law states that the induced electromotive force (emf) in a closed circuit is directly proportional to the rate of change of magnetic flux through the circuit.

What does Lenz's Law describe?
Back
Lenz's Law states that the direction of the induced current is such that it opposes the change in magnetic flux that produced it.

How does an increase in magnetic flux affect induced current?
Back
An increase in magnetic flux through a circuit induces a current in a direction that opposes the increase, according to Lenz's Law.

What is the formula for calculating induced emf?
Back
The formula for induced emf (ε) is ε = -dΦ/dt, where Φ is the magnetic flux.

What is magnetic flux?
Back
Magnetic flux (Φ) is the product of the magnetic field (B) and the area (A) through which it passes, and it is given by the formula Φ = B * A * cos(θ), where θ is the angle between the magnetic field and the normal to the surface.
